How Our Office Building Water Extraction Service Works

Our team's process for Office Building Water Extraction is designed to reduce damage and get your business back up and running as soon as possible. We'll assess the situation, extract the water, and dry out the affected area, all while ensuring your property remains safe for occupants.

Water Damage Assessment

Our technicians will quickly assess the extent of the water damage, identifying areas that need immediate attention. This ensures we focus on the most critical tasks and allocate resources effectively.

Water Extraction

We'll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your office building, reducing the risk of further damage and ensuring a safe environment for occupants.

Drying and Dehumidification

Our equipment will dry out the affected area, removing excess moisture and preventing mold growth. This also helps to speed up the restoration process.

Monitoring and Follow-up

We'll closely monitor the drying process to ensure everything is proceeding according to plan. This may involve adjusting equipment or setting up more measures to prevent further damage.

Final Inspection and Cleanup

Once the area is completely dry, we'll conduct a final inspection to ensure everything is safe and secure. We'll also cl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ent future problems.

Office Building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Standing water in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es, DIY is fine No need to call a pro Small areas are usually manageable with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ease.
Large-scale water damage or flood No, don't DIY Call a pro Large-scale water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., near electrical systems) No, don't DIY Call a pro Water damage near electrical systems can be hazardous and needs professional attention to prevent electrical shock or fires.
Water damage in a high-traffic area No, don't DIY Call a pro High-traffic areas need rapid attention to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ment for occupants.
Water damage in a large office building or commercial property No, don't DIY Call a pro Large office buildings or commercial properties need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.

Office Building Water Extraction Cost in Danbury, TX

The cost of Office Building Water Extraction in Danbury, TX can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are estimated price ranges for common Office Building Water Extraction services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ction (small area, less than 100 sq. Ft.) $500 - $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Water Extraction (large area, 100-500 sq. Ft.) $1,500 - $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Water Drying and Dehumidification (small area) $1,000 - $3,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Water Drying and Dehumidification (large area) $3,000 - $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Full Restoration (including water extraction, drying, and rebuilding) $10,000 - $50,000+ Size of affected area, severity of damage, local conditions, and type of materials and finishes.
